What are some alternative ways to convert cryptocurrency into traditional currency without having a bank account?
I'm looking for alternative methods to convert cryptocurrency into traditional currency without the need for a bank account. Can you suggest any options that allow me to cash out my cryptocurrency holdings?
4 answers
- Joseph GMay 21, 2025 · a year agoSure thing! If you don't have a bank account, you can consider using peer-to-peer cryptocurrency exchanges. These platforms conn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ing you to exchange your cryptocurrency for traditional currency without involving a bank. Some popular peer-to-peer exchanges include LocalBitcoins and Paxful. Just be cautious and ensure you're dealing with reputable traders to avoid any potential scams.
- S StFeb 10, 2021 · 5 years agoNo bank account? No problem! Another option is to use Bitcoin ATMs. These machines allow you to convert your cryptocurrency into cash directly. Simply find a Bitcoin ATM near you, follow the instructions on the screen, and voila! Keep in mind that Bitcoin ATMs may have transaction limits and charge fees, so it's essential to check these details beforehand.

- SzeniFeb 28, 2023 · 3 years agoDon't want to involve a bank? How about using a prepaid debit card? Some cryptocurrency exchanges and platforms offer prepaid cards that you can load with your cryptocurrency. These cards can be used to make purchases or withdraw cash from ATMs, providing you with a convenient way to convert your cryptocurrency into traditional currency. Just keep in mind that these cards may have certain limitations and fees, so it's important to read the terms and conditions before getting one.
